I use Ruby. In the following example I use a replacement tag "#{lvl}" in the scripts. For each of the levels (indv,hhld,resi), I do a substitution against the script and pass the script to sqlite.
dbname = File.join('d:','cloveretl','projects','test_ii','data-out-97','test.db') db = SQLite3::Database.new(dbname) script_folder = File.join(prj.ps_project_folder,'scripts') scripts_to_run = [ '02_build_relationships.sql', '05_cdi_perspective.sql', '05_itrack_perspective.sql', '10_cdi_select', '10_itrack_select' ] ['indv','hhld','resi'].each {|lvl| puts "Executing level: #{lvl}" scripts_to_run.each {|sql| puts " script: #{sql}" script = File.open(File.join(script_folder,sql)).readlines(sep=nil)[0] db.execute_batch(script.gsub('#{lvl}',lvl)) } } On Fri, Jun 15, 2012 at 5:01 AM, Niall O'Reilly <niall.orei...@ucd.ie>wrote: > > On 15 Jun 2012, at 10:45, Udi Karni wrote: > > > Niall - thanks.
